Question Which site is the best buy OEM KIA parts?

I just picked up a '13 Rio5 LX+ on Sunday and have been lurking around these forums for the last two weeks or so. I'm not new to car forums, so trust me when I say I did search for this, but came up empty handed.

Is there a specific site you guys prefer to buy from when looking for OEM parts and accessories? I know there were a few for Subaru and Scion (when I owned those vehicles) that had very good pricing and service.

In particular, I'm looking for the rear cargo tray:
Product Code: 1W012 ADU05

I did a google search of that part number and found various pricing; as low as $51.95 and as high as $65.95.

Here are a couple of examples:
OEM 2013 2012 Kia Rio5 5 Door Hatchback Cargo Tray Mat Liner # 1W012 ADU05

Kia Rio 5-Door Cargo Tray (E064)


So, if you have a favorite site that you have used and would recommend, can you help a brother out?

Default Kia Rio Auto Dimming Mirror with Homelink and Compass

Hi Sdgc,

Sorry for the current lack of information on our site for this accessory. We are going through and refining the website's navigation, pictures and product descriptions.

BUT ANY WHO!!!! The homelink is actually a fairly simple thing to do. There is absolutely some programming. But from what we understand, if you can program and tv remote to your tv, then you can program this to your door. This will come with some installation instructions. You'll need to know the frequency of operating it with your door, which should be simple to find.

Hopefully this info helps you out on the product. Let us know if you need any more help!
